How is an atmosphere built—one that stays in your memory?


At Brod, every detail is carefully considered — including the lighting.

Brod’s General Manager, Nata Zarnadze, shares how the lighting was selected to match the interior and why proper lighting is essential to the guest experience.


Nata Zarnadze:"There are many details to consider in a restaurant interior because the space is made up of many components, and all of these elements need to blend together harmoniously.


During the day, natural light enters the space. The main windows face south, and throughout the day, the sunlight creates beautiful shadows inside.


We wanted to maintain this effect in the evening, planning the lighting so that the transition from day to night would feel natural and beautiful.


One of the most important elements was lighting — and distributing it thoughtfully and meaningfully throughout the space.


In the evenings, we wanted to create an atmosphere that would make guests feel comfortable and bring a sense of coziness. I think we succeeded."


Restaurant Brod opened in April. The interior design was done by Nino Shvangiradze – D-Collective.


Nino Shvangiradze:"Lighting played a crucial role in shaping the design. We had a solid structure to begin with — an old brick building with its own history.


The concept and the brief were to create a minimalist interior with Danish influence — very calm, warm, and cozy.


As for the Nordlux lighting, they are a significant part of the interior. Together with the wooden panels, they create a contrast — the metal of the lamps highlights and elevates the wood, making it feel more refined."
